Engine Oil for the 2015 Subaru Forester: What You Need to Know

The 2015 Subaru Forester, like most internal combustion engine vehicles, absolutely relies on engine oil to keep everything running smoothly. Engine oil plays a crucial role in the health and performance of the Forester's engine, making it an essential maintenance item for any owner. This supple fluid ensures the engine parts work efficiently and last longer, so understanding its purpose and replacement schedule is key.

Engine oil is basically the lifeblood of the vehicle's engine. It lubricates the many moving parts inside the engine, such as pistons, crankshafts, and camshafts. Without that lubrication, metal components would rub against each other, creating friction and heat. This could rapidly wear parts down and cause serious damage. Beyond just lubricating, engine oil also helps with cooling, carrying heat away from crucial moving parts that can get very hot during operation.

Another important job of engine oil is to keep the engine clean. As the oil circulates, it picks up dirt, bits of metal, and combustion residues that gather inside the engine. Special additives in the oil help neutralise acids and prevent sludge build-up, which is key for maintaining engine efficiency over time. Plus, the oil forms a seal between the piston rings and cylinder walls, which boosts engine power and fuel economy.

In the 2015 Subaru Forester, regular oil changes are necessary to keep this vital fluid fresh and effective. Over time, engine oil breaks down and becomes less capable of protecting the engine. Contaminants build up and the oil's viscosity changes, making it less efficient at lubricating and cooling. That's why sticking to the manufacturer's recommended oil change intervals is so important.

Subaru typically recommends changing the engine oil every 6,000 to 10,000 kilometres, depending on driving conditions. For Australian drivers who often face dusty roads or endure stop-start city traffic, sticking closer to the 6,000-kilometre mark is a smart move. Using the right oil type is just as critical - for the 2015 Forester, Subaru generally specifies a synthetic 0W-20 or 5W-30 oil, both of which help the engine start easily in various temperatures and maintain good flow during operation.

When it comes to maintaining your Forester's engine oil, here are some handy tips:

  • Always use high-quality oils that meet the Subaru specifications. Synthetic oils tend to offer better protection and last longer than conventional oils.
  • Check the oil level regularly, especially if the Forester is used for towing, off-road driving or in extreme temperatures. Low oil levels can cause serious engine problems.
  • Replace the oil filter every time you change the oil. The filter traps contaminants and prevents them from circulating back into the engine.
  • Stick to an oil change schedule and don't delay. Putting it off can cause sludge build-up and reduce engine life.

For those who like doing their own maintenance, changing the oil on a 2015 Subaru Forester is fairly straightforward. You'll need the correct grade of synthetic oil, a new oil filter, some basic tools, and a bit of patience. Always make sure the vehicle is parked on level ground and the engine is cool before starting. Remember to properly dispose of used oil in an environmentally responsible way - most local workshops or councils have designated oil disposal programs.

Professional servicing is also a great option if you want peace of mind. Subaru service centres and reputable mechanics will use genuine parts and recommended fluids to keep your Forester engine in tip-top shape. They will also perform a thorough inspection to catch potential issues before they become costly repairs.
